  • Publication number: 20240144351
    Abstract: Techniques described herein relate to a method for performing capacity planning services. The method includes obtaining a current CP state from a client; in response to obtaining the current state: selecting an action based on the current CP state; providing the action to the client, wherein the client performs the action; in response to providing the action: obtaining a new CP state and a headcount associated with the action; calculating a reward based on the headcount and a reward formula; storing the current CP state, the action, the new CP state, and the reward as a learning set in storage comprising a plurality of learning sets; and performing a learning update using a portion of the plurality of learning sets to generate an updated actor, an updated critic, an updated target actor, and an updated target critic.

  • Publication number: 20240135429
    Abstract: Techniques described herein relate to a method for generating address recommendations. The method includes obtaining, by a recommendation system, an address recommendation request associated with an address, wherein the address is associated with a user; in response to obtaining the address recommendation request: generating a context vector associated with the address; generating an address recommendation based on the context vector using a recommendation model; obtaining user feedback associated with the address recommendation; generating a reward based on the user feedback; and updating the recommendation model based on the context vector, the address recommendation and the reward.

  • Patent number: 11847679
    Abstract: A system can determine a first persona for a user identity. The system can generate a web page based on the first persona, wherein respective reinforcement learning agents determine respective content of respective content modules of the website, wherein the reinforcement agents operate on an environment that comprises a group of states, a group of actions, and a group of rewards that are based on the group of states, and respective actions of the group of actions, and wherein a reward of the respective reinforcement learning agents that is increased via reinforcement learning is based on a sum of respective rewards of the respective reinforcement learning agents in transitioning the user identity to a second persona with respect to the website. The system can, in response to receiving first action data indicative of user identity interaction with the web page, transition the user identity to the second persona.

  • Publication number: 20220326840
    Abstract: Machine learning techniques can be implemented to provide personalized websites. In an example, a group of training inputs is determined. A training input of the group of training inputs can comprise a current state that indicates a visit to a website via a user device, an action that indicates a recommendation rendered via the user device during the visit to the website, a user reward that indicates whether user input associated with a user identity via the user device interacted with the recommendation, and a next state that indicates a state of the website for the user device in response to the action being taken from the current state. The training inputs can be used for performing batch offline neural fitted Q iteration training on a neural network to produce a trained neural network. The trained neural network can be stored.
